It’s a busy night in the NBA with 11 games on tap. Nothing early, meaning you’ll have to wait until 7 P.M. ET to get your hoops fix. That’s when the Hawks will take on the Wizards and the Clippers meet the Pelicans. Two games at 8 P.M. ET as well with the Kings taking their two-game win streak into New York against the Knicks and the Grizzlies looking to slow down the Rockets for the third time. 8:30 p.m. ET has the Cavaliers searching for defense against the Mavericks, the Lakers meeting the Bucks, the Bulls tussling with the Spurs, and the 76ers looking into their future mirror against the Warriors. The latest slate of games takes place at 9:00 p.m. ET with the Magic battling the altitude and the Nuggets, the Timberwolves squaring off with the Suns, and the Nets facing the Jazz.

Each day in order to offer a variety of price points at each position, you can find two slides for each position–one for high-salary options and one for high-value options. Each pick is ranked on a scale of 1-5 stars to indicate the confidence in the pick. The final slide of this post has more detail on what each level means, but in short, more stars means more confidence in the selection on a points-per-dollar basis.
